Roger Cleveland on the art and science of designing the Mack Daddy 4 wedges

Published

on

Callaway Golf’s Chief Designer Roger Cleveland talks with host Michael Williams about the art and science behind the new Mack Daddy 4 wedges in this special edition of the 19th Hole.
